Located in the architecturally striking Scheiblhofer The Resort hotel, this stylish modern restaurant is nestled amid the vineyards. The glass-walled dining area affords stunning views while you savour contemporary cuisine with a Pannonian twist. The menu features dishes such as hamachi sashimi with caviar, apricots, passion fruit, yellow pepper, leche de tigre and maize, or Pannonian pike-perch bisque. The property also boasts a winery, Weingut Scheiblhofer, and wine is also an important part of the experience – the impressive selection naturally includes many of their own making.

Steeped in tradition, this restaurant in the centre of Podersdorf has been run by the same family for four generations. Their ties to the region are reflected in delicious dishes made with ingredients from the owner's native Burgenland. The handwritten menu features classics such as veal liver and schnitzel, as well as options including pan-fried Arctic char fillet with pak choi and celeriac cream. A tip to start off with: in summer, don't miss out on the terrace with a view of the Danube – it's idyllic! That's not to say the kitchen doesn't also deliver its fair share of delights: the beautifully prepared regional dishes are packed with flavour, from Wiener schnitzel (made with veal), potatoes and lamb's lettuce salad, to delicious ravioli or Arctic char fillet, to 24hr-braised ox cheek. Be sure to try the house-made vinegar-based lemonades, too. Hot meals served throughout the day.
